MS SB2126
Bill
AI Summary
-
Amends the Critical Needs Teacher Scholarship Program to require a minimum of two scholarship awards per Mississippi Congressional District for education students who commit to teaching Advanced Placement (AP) courses, beginning with the 2013-2014 school year.
-
Maintains existing scholarship structure providing full financial awards for tuition, room, meals, books, materials, and fees, capped at the highest cost among state institutions of higher learning.
-
Preserves loan repayment assistance for nontraditional licensed teachers in critical shortage areas, with maximum annual repayment of $3,000 over no more than four years.
-
Requires scholarship recipients to serve as licensed teachers for one year per year of full-time scholarship received in geographical areas or subject areas designated as having critical teacher shortages.
-
Takes effect July 1, 2013.
Legislative Description
Critical Needs Teacher Scholarship Program; earmark minimum number of awards for teachers of advanced placement courses.
Last Action
Died In Committee
2/5/2013
